学编程需要什么东西呢女生
发表时间:2024-12-06 12:16文章来源:技昂编程网
了解编程的基本概念
在正式学习编程之前,首先需要了解一些基本概念
编程语言:编程语言是计算机与人类之间的沟通工具。常见的编程语言有Python、Java、JavaScript、C++等。不同的语言适用于不同的应用场景。
算法与数据结构:编程不仅仅是写代码,理解算法和数据结构是解决问题的关键。这些概念有助于提高代码的效率和可读性。
开发环境:编程需要一个开发环境,比如IDE(集成开发环境)或文本编辑器。常用的IDE有Visual Studio Code、PyCharm等。
选择合适的编程语言
选择一门合适的编程语言是学习的第一步。对于初学者而言,Python是一种极为推荐的语言,因为它语法简单,容易上手。其他一些适合初学者的语言还包括
JavaScript:适合前端开发,网页互动效果的实现。
Ruby:语法优美,适合快速开发。
Scratch:图形化编程语言,适合小朋友及零基础学习者。
学习资源的选择
在学习编程的过程中,选择合适的学习资源至关重要。以下是一些推荐的学习渠道
在线课程
Coursera、edX:这些平台上有许多大学教授的编程课程,内容全面且系统。
Codecademy:提供互动式的编程课程,适合初学者。
书籍推荐
Python编程:从入门到实践:适合初学者,内容易懂且实用。
算法图解:通俗易懂地讲解算法,适合希望深入学习的学生。
视频教程
YouTube:上面有很多优质的编程教程,讲解细致,适合视觉学习者。
Bilibili:国内用户可以在B站找到很多编程相关的学习视频,内容丰富。
学习编程最重要的一点是实践。通过实际操作来巩固所学知识,可以尝试以下方法
完成编程练习
网站如LeetCode、HackerRank、Codewars提供了丰富的编程题目,可以帮助你提高解决问题的能力。
参与开源项目
在GitHub上寻找开源项目,贡献代码。这不仅能锻炼你的编程能力,还能让你了解团队协作的流程。
自己动手做项目
从简单的小项目开始,比如制作一个个人网站、开发一个小工具等。通过项目实践,你能更好地理解编程的应用场景。
建立学习社区
学习编程不应该是一条孤独的道路,加入学习社区可以让你获得支持与鼓励。可以选择以下几种方式
线下活动
参加本地的编程活动或技术分享会,与志同道合的人交流。许多城市都有专门为女性举办的技术沙龙,如Girl Develop It等。
在线论坛
加入一些编程相关的论坛或社交媒体群组,如Stack Overflow、Reddit等。你可以在这里提问、分享经验,或者寻找合作伙伴。
学习小组
组建或加入学习小组,与其他学习者一起分享进展、讨论问题,共同进步。
克服挑战与保持动力
学习编程的过程中难免会遇到困难,特别是对于初学者来说,解决问题时可能会感到挫败。以下是一些保持动力的方法
制定学习计划
设定明确的学习目标和计划,比如每天学习一小时,每周完成一个小项目。这能帮助你保持学习的节奏。
记录进步
定期记录自己的学习进展,包括掌握的新知识、完成的项目等。这能让你看到自己的成长,增强自信心。
寻找榜样
关注一些女性程序员的故事,她们的经历能给你带来启发和动力。许多成功的女性程序员分享了她们的学习之路和职业发展,值得借鉴。
未来的职业发展
学习编程不仅可以提升个人技能,还有助于职业发展。随着技术的快速发展,编程相关的职业需求也在不断增加。以下是一些潜在的职业方向
软件开发工程师:负责软件的设计、开发和维护。
数据分析师:通过编程分析数据,帮助企业做出决策。
前端/后端开发者:专注于网站或应用的用户界面和服务器端开发。
机器学习工程师:利用编程与算法开发智能系统。
学习编程是一个充满挑战与机遇的过程,尤其对女性而言,掌握编程技能将为你打开更多职业的大门。通过选择合适的资源、积极参与实践、建立学习社区,你将能够克服困难,实现自己的编程梦想。记住,学习编程的旅程虽然艰辛,但每一步的努力都是值得的。希望你能在编程的世界中找到自己的热情与成就!
- 上一篇:数据编程是什么专业
- 下一篇:学编程都要学哪些科目和内容
- 学编程应该用什么软件 05-12
- 如何学编程入门基础 05-21
- python能做什么 06-09
- 程序员需要学好什么科目 06-10
- 初学编程应该先学什么语言 07-04
- cnc编程需要什么基础设备 07-11